电器设备的控制方法及系统、网关设备技术方案

技术编号:38866148 阅读:9 留言:0更新日期:2023-09-22 14:05
本申请公开了一种电器设备的控制方法及系统、网关设备。其中,该方法包括:网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令;网关设备对第一控制指令进行解析,得到第一控制指令对应的操作信息,其中,操作信息用于控制电器设备执行与操作信息对应的操作;网关设备通过第二无线传输协议将操作信息发送至电器设备,其中,第一无线传输协议与第二无线传输协议为不同的协议。本申请解决了由于相关的电器设备控制方法存在较高的网络时延造成的用户在对电器设备进行控制时存在明显的异步感的技术问题。题。题。

【技术实现步骤摘要】
电器设备的控制方法及系统、网关设备


[0001]本申请涉及电器设备控制领域,具体而言,涉及一种电器设备的控制方法及系统、网关设备。

技术介绍

[0002]目前基于Zigbee协议的智能家居系统中,灯具与网关之间通过Zigbee网络进行通信;网关和云端物联网平台通信,通过基于TCP协议建立的长连接;手机APP通过HTTP/HTTPS请求与云端物联网进行平台通信。因此,要实现手机APP对Zigbee灯具的控制,以开灯这个动作为例,完整的通信链路为:手机APP发送开灯的HTTP/HTTPS请求给云端物联网平台,物联网平台发送开灯指令的MQTT消息,网关订阅并解析该MQTT消息,再通过Zigbee网络发送开灯指令给灯具,灯具接收到指令后对控制器进行控制。
[0003]从智能家居交互体验角度讲,低于400ms的延迟可以达到无异步感,400ms

1000ms的延迟会存在轻微的异步感,高于1000ms的延迟存在明显异步感。从用户在APP上发出的开灯指令到灯被打开,涉及的通信链路长,通信节点多,每个环节的通信都会产生网络时延,包括处理时延、排队时延、传输时延、传播时延等,加上应用系统的处理性能,整体的延迟大于2000ms,存在明显异步感,用户交互体验差。而由于延迟较高,无法通过APP对灯具进行无极调光。
[0004]针对上述的问题,目前尚未提出有效的解决方案。

技术实现思路

[0005]本申请实施例提供了一种电器设备的控制方法及系统、网关设备,以至少解决由于相关的电器设备控制方法存在较高的网络时延造成的用户在对电器设备进行控制时存在明显的异步感的技术问题。
[0006]根据本申请实施例的一个方面,提供了一种电器设备的控制方法,包括:网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令;网关设备对第一控制指令进行解析,得到第一控制指令对应的操作信息,其中,操作信息用于控制电器设备执行与操作信息对应的操作;网关设备通过第二无线传输协议将操作信息发送至电器设备,其中,第一无线传输协议与第二无线传输协议为不同的协议。
[0007]可选地,网关设备中设置有蓝牙模块,第一无线传输协议至少包括:蓝牙传输协议;网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令,包括:网关设备接收终端设备发送的蓝牙特征值,其中,蓝牙特征值为通过蓝牙传输协议进行数据传输时所需的参数,蓝牙特征值中包括第一控制指令。
[0008]可选地,网关设备接收终端设备发送的蓝牙特征值之前,方法还包括:网关设备启动蓝牙模块;网关设备检测与网关设备的蓝牙模块匹配的终端设备,并在检测到终端设备的情况下,通过网关设备的蓝牙模块与终端设备的蓝牙模块建立连接;网关设备接收终端设备发送的蓝牙特征值之后,方法还包括:网关设备通过自身的蓝牙模块检测来自终端设
备的蓝牙模块发送的数据。
[0009]可选地,在网关设备未检测到与网关设备的蓝牙模块匹配的终端设备的情况下,网关设备接收来自服务器的用于对电器设备进行控制的第二控制指令,其中,服务器用于接收终端设备发送的用于对电器设备进行控制的控制指令。
[0010]可选地,网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令,还包括:网关设备依次接收来自终端设备的多个控制指令;对接收到的多个控制指令执行计时操作,得到多个计时结果;确定多个计时结果中的目标计时结果对应的控制指令为多个控制指令中的结束控制指令,其中,目标计时结果为多个计时结果中大于预设阈值的计时结果。
[0011]可选地,第二无线传输协议至少包括:ZigBee传输协议。
[0012]根据本申请实施例的再一方面,还提供了一种电器设备的控制方法,包括:终端设备基于第一无线传输协议将用于对电器设备进行控制的第一控制指令发送至与终端设备进行数据传输的网关设备,以通过网关设备完成对电器设备的控制,其中,网关设备用于对第一控制指令进行解析,得到第一控制指令对应的操作信息,其中,操作信息用于控制电器设备执行与操作信息对应的操作,网关设备还用于通过第二无线传输协议将操作信息发送至电器设备,其中,第一无线传输协议与第二无线传输协议为不同的协议。
[0013]可选地,终端设备将用于对电器设备进行控制的第一控制指令发送至与终端设备进行数据传输的网关设备之前,方法还包括:终端设备接收目标对象基于终端设备的应用程序所发送的第三控制指令,其中,第三控制指令用于对电器设备进行控制,其中,电器设备至少包括:支持第二无线传输协议的可调光灯具,控制至少包括:无极调光控制;终端设备将第三控制指令转化为基于第一无线传输协议的第一控制指令。
[0014]根据本申请实施例的再一方面,还提供了一种电器设备的控制系统,包括:终端设备以及网关设备,其中,终端设备与网关设备进行数据交互,终端设备用于将第一控制指令发送至与终端设备进行数据传输的网关设备,以通过网关设备完成对电器设备的控制,其中,第一控制指令用于对电器设备进行控制;网关设备用于基于第一无线传输协议接收来自终端设备的第一控制指令,并对第一控制指令进行解析,得到第一控制指令对应的操作信息,其中,操作信息用于控制电器设备执行与操作信息对应的操作;网关设备还用于通过第二无线传输协议将操作信息发送至电器设备,其中,第一无线传输协议与第二无线传输协议为不同的协议。
[0015]根据本申请实施例的再一方面,还提供了一种网关设备,包括:蓝牙模块以及控制器,其中,蓝牙模块,用于接收终端设备发送的蓝牙特征值,其中,蓝牙特征值为通过蓝牙传输协议进行数据传输时所需的参数,蓝牙特征值中包括第一控制指令,其中,第一控制指令用于指示控制器对电器设备进行控制;控制器,用于通过第二无线传输协议将第一控制指令对应的操作信息发送至电器设备,以完成对电器设备的控制。
[0016]根据本申请实施例的再一方面,还提供了一种非易失性存储介质,存储介质包括存储的程序,其中,程序运行时控制存储介质所在的设备执行以上的电器设备的控制方法。
[0017]在本申请实施例中,采用网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令;网关设备对第一控制指令进行解析,得到第一控制指令对应的操作信息,其中,操作信息用于控制电器设备执行与操作信息对应的操作;网
关设备通过第二无线传输协议将操作信息发送至电器设备,其中,第一无线传输协议与第二无线传输协议为不同的协议的方式,通过网关设备直接接收移动终端发送的控制指令,并将该控制指令发送至电器设备,达到了降低对电器设备进行控制的时延的目的,从而实现了用户在对电器设备进行控制时达到无异步感的技术效果,进而解决了由于相关的电器设备控制方法存在较高的网络时延造成的用户在对电器设备进行控制时存在明显的异步感的技术问题。
附图说明
[0018]此处所说明的附图用来提供对本申请的进一步理解,构成本申请的一部分,本申请的示意性实施例及其说明用于解释本申本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种电器设备的控制方法,其特征在于,包括:网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令;所述网关设备对所述第一控制指令进行解析,得到所述第一控制指令对应的操作信息,其中,所述操作信息用于控制所述电器设备执行与所述操作信息对应的操作;所述网关设备通过第二无线传输协议将所述操作信息发送至所述电器设备,其中,所述第一无线传输协议与所述第二无线传输协议为不同的协议。2.根据权利要求1所述的方法,其特征在于,所述网关设备中设置有蓝牙模块,所述第一无线传输协议至少包括:蓝牙传输协议;网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令,包括:所述网关设备接收所述终端设备发送的蓝牙特征值,其中,所述蓝牙特征值为通过所述蓝牙传输协议进行数据传输时所需的参数,所述蓝牙特征值中包括所述第一控制指令。3.根据权利要求2所述的方法,其特征在于,所述网关设备接收所述终端设备发送的蓝牙特征值之前,所述方法还包括:所述网关设备启动所述蓝牙模块;所述网关设备检测与所述网关设备的蓝牙模块匹配的所述终端设备,并在检测到所述终端设备的情况下,通过所述网关设备的蓝牙模块与所述终端设备的蓝牙模块建立连接;所述网关设备接收所述终端设备发送的蓝牙特征值之后,所述方法还包括:所述网关设备通过自身的蓝牙模块检测来自所述终端设备的蓝牙模块发送的数据。4.根据权利要求3所述的方法,其特征在于,所述方法还包括:在所述网关设备未检测到与所述网关设备的蓝牙模块匹配的所述终端设备的情况下,所述网关设备接收来自服务器的用于对所述电器设备进行控制的第二控制指令,其中,所述服务器用于接收所述终端设备发送的用于对所述电器设备进行控制的控制指令。5.根据权利要求1所述的方法,其特征在于,网关设备基于第一无线传输协议接收来自终端设备的用于对电器设备进行控制的第一控制指令,还包括:所述网关设备依次接收来自所述终端设备的多个控制指令;对接收到的所述多个控制指令执行计时操作,得到多个计时结果;确定所述多个计时结果中的目标计时结果对应的控制指令为所述多个控制指令中的结束控制指令,其中,所述目标计时结果为所述多个计时结果中大于预设阈值的计时结果。6.根据权利要求1所述的方法,其特征在于,所述第二无线传输协议至少包括:Zigbee传输协议。7.一种电器设备的控制方法,其特征在于,包括:终端设备基于第一无线传输协议将用于对电器设备进行控制的...

【专利技术属性】
技术研发人员:章锦跃李德升茅隽东
申请(专利权)人:杭州鸿雁电器有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1